Really hearty prawn noodle soup, juicy prawns. I had the small “large prawn noodle” and it came with 3 prawns of different sizes, noodles with some bean sprouts and fried shallots. Highlight was really the soup. The prawns are great but overall, not a lot of value in this considering it was $7. You can choose the type of noodles from yellow, white beehoon and flat rice noodles, and request for the prawns to come peeled. It closes for a couple of hours in the afternoon so check the new operating hours before heading down.

It’s been a while since I last had Hoe Nam prawn noodles back at their old location across the street. Their new outlet at The Venue shoppes is now air-conditioned, offering a more comfortable dining environment. The ladies taking orders are polite and friendly, which adds to the pleasant experience. Portions are decent, though I find the taste rather average. The soup leans more towards a porky flavor than the rich prawn broth I was hoping for. Overall, it’s still a decent spot to satisfy the occasional prawn noodle craving, but not one I’d go out of my way for.
